Job Description:

Menzies Distribution Solutions are looking for an experienced Sub-Contraction Manager to join our Planning Centre in Wakefield. The job holder will manage all aspects of MDS Sub-Contraction. Relationships with partners and Haulage Hub. Will also be required to consistently challenge the status quo to ensure that our subcontractor activity supports our overall Transport Optimisation goals. Strives to build relationships maximizing profitability at every opportunity.

Key Duties and Accountabilities (will include but not be limited to)

  • Tactical relationship management of Haulage Hub and existing subcontractors
  • Undertake periodic audits
  • Implement and maintain a rate-card approach for subcontractors by depot
  • Point of contact for subcontractor disputes / issues
  • Manage requirements with HaulageHub for new subcontractors.
  • Manage subcontractor reporting regime, development and introduction of MDS/ HH standard KPI’s
  • Lead on subcontractor related projects
  • Undertake other activities as required related to overall Transport Optimization goals, and wider business objectives as required

Key Experience and Qualifications

  • An experienced transport professional
  • Experience of using digital transport solutions such as HaulageHub.
  • Demonstrable experience in negotiating with subcontractors
  • Must have a thorough grasp of transport costs, and good all-round financial acumen
  • Operationally focused, but with the ability to identify opportunities and challenge convention
  • Must be comfortable with data manipulation to produce meaningful reports / analysis with an eye for detail
  • CPC preferred but not essential.
